The Role of Small Business Data

In this era of digital transformation, data reigns supreme. Within the context of corporate decision-making, small business data emerges as a pivotal asset. The essence of this data lies in its depth and breadth. Small business data is a rich resource that encapsulates key aspects of an SMB’s operations, such as their financial health, loan history, revenue growth, and credit profile.

Every data point creates a sharper picture of the SMB’s standing. It illuminates the paths that a corporation can take while considering partnerships, collaborations, or investments in these businesses. More importantly, this data allows corporations to navigate away from potential pitfalls or risky ventures.

The Importance of Small Business Data for Corporations

A question then arises: Why is small business data so vital for corporations? The answer lies in the nature of the corporate world itself. It is an environment where every decision can lead to a cascade of outcomes, some desirable and others less so.

Analyzing small business data equips corporations with the knowledge they need to predict these outcomes more accurately. When an enterprise looks at a small business’s financial health, it gains an understanding of the latter’s ability to sustain and succeed in a demanding market. Similarly, a lender assessing a small business’s loan history can gauge the likelihood of repayment.

Thus, the value of small business data is both multilayered and versatile. It aids in identifying opportunities, forecasting growth, managing risks, and setting realistic expectations for every transaction or agreement involving SMBs.
